Responsibilities

  • Act as “our customer’s best service provider”, always, thereby ensuring SIGNET is the customer’s first choice for service
  • Assist in the completion of healthcare communication, security and other low voltage electronic systems testing and inspections
  • Assist in the creation of reports to identify problems or discrepancies resulting from the inspection
  • Complete reports and paperwork associated with the inspection
  • Interact with client representatives prior to, during and after completion of the testing process
  • Assist with the review of the report results and next steps as necessary
  • Share reports with other departments, to resolve issues or discrepancies
  • Ensure proper testing equipment and materials are onsite for effective and safe testing and inspection process
  • Support lead service technicians in system moves, adds and changes (as required)
  • Act as a lead on smaller system tests after proper training is completed
